package com.twitter.distributedlog;
import com.twitter.distributedlog.exceptions.OverCapacityException;
import com.twitter.distributedlog.util.PermitLimiter;
import com.twitter.distributedlog.util.SimplePermitLimiter;
import org.apache.bookkeeper.feature.Feature;
import org.apache.bookkeeper.feature.SettableFeature;
import org.apache.bookkeeper.stats.NullStatsLogger;
import org.junit.Test;
import org.slf4j.Logger;
import org.slf4j.LoggerFactory;
import static org.junit.Assert.assertEquals;
import static org.junit.Assert.fail;
import scala.runtime.BoxedUnit;
public class TestWriteLimiter {
static final Logger LOG = LoggerFactory.getLogger(TestWriteLimiter.class);
SimplePermitLimiter createPermitLimiter(boolean darkmode, int permits) {
return createPermitLimiter(darkmode, permits, new SettableFeature("", 0));
}
SimplePermitLimiter createPermitLimiter(boolean darkmode, int permits, Feature feature) {
return new SimplePermitLimiter(darkmode, permits, new NullStatsLogger(), false, feature);
}
@Test(timeout = 60000)
public void testGlobalOnly() throws Exception {
SimplePermitLimiter streamLimiter = createPermitLimiter(false, Integer.MAX_VALUE);
SimplePermitLimiter globalLimiter = createPermitLimiter(false, 1);
WriteLimiter limiter = new WriteLimiter("test", streamLimiter, globalLimiter);
limiter.acquire();
try {
limiter.acquire();
fail("should have thrown global limit exception");
} catch (OverCapacityException ex) {
}
assertPermits(streamLimiter, 1, globalLimiter, 1);
limiter.release();
assertPermits(streamLimiter, 0, globalLimiter, 0);
}
@Test(timeout = 60000)
public void testStreamOnly() throws Exception {
SimplePermitLimiter streamLimiter = createPermitLimiter(false, 1);
SimplePermitLimiter globalLimiter = createPermitLimiter(false, Integer.MAX_VALUE);
WriteLimiter limiter = new WriteLimiter("test", streamLimiter, globalLimiter);
limiter.acquire();
try {
limiter.acquire();
fail("should have thrown stream limit exception");
} catch (OverCapacityException ex) {
}
assertPermits(streamLimiter, 1, globalLimiter, 1);
}
@Test(timeout = 60000)
public void testDarkmode() throws Exception {
SimplePermitLimiter streamLimiter = createPermitLimiter(true, Integer.MAX_VALUE);
SimplePermitLimiter globalLimiter = createPermitLimiter(true, 1);
WriteLimiter limiter = new WriteLimiter("test", streamLimiter, globalLimiter);
limiter.acquire();
limiter.acquire();
assertPermits(streamLimiter, 2, globalLimiter, 2);
}
@Test(timeout = 60000)
public void testDarkmodeWithDisabledFeature() throws Exception {
SettableFeature feature = new SettableFeature("test", 10000);
SimplePermitLimiter streamLimiter = createPermitLimiter(true, 1, feature);
SimplePermitLimiter globalLimiter = createPermitLimiter(true, Integer.MAX_VALUE, feature);
WriteLimiter limiter = new WriteLimiter("test", streamLimiter, globalLimiter);
limiter.acquire();
limiter.acquire();
assertPermits(streamLimiter, 2, globalLimiter, 2);
limiter.release();
limiter.release();
assertPermits(streamLimiter, 0, globalLimiter, 0);
}
@Test(timeout = 60000)
public void testDisabledFeature() throws Exception {
// Disable darkmode, but should still ignore limits because of the feature.
SettableFeature feature = new SettableFeature("test", 10000);
SimplePermitLimiter streamLimiter = createPermitLimiter(false, 1, feature);
SimplePermitLimiter globalLimiter = createPermitLimiter(false, Integer.MAX_VALUE, feature);
WriteLimiter limiter = new WriteLimiter("test", streamLimiter, globalLimiter);
limiter.acquire();
limiter.acquire();
assertPermits(streamLimiter, 2, globalLimiter, 2);
limiter.release();
limiter.release();
assertPermits(streamLimiter, 0, globalLimiter, 0);
}
@Test(timeout = 60000)
public void testSetDisableFeatureAfterAcquireAndBeforeRelease() throws Exception {
SettableFeature feature = new SettableFeature("test", 0);
SimplePermitLimiter streamLimiter = createPermitLimiter(false, 2, feature);
SimplePermitLimiter globalLimiter = createPermitLimiter(false, Integer.MAX_VALUE, feature);
WriteLimiter limiter = new WriteLimiter("test", streamLimiter, globalLimiter);
limiter.acquire();
limiter.acquire();
assertPermits(streamLimiter, 2, globalLimiter, 2);
feature.set(10000);
limiter.release();
limiter.release();
assertPermits(streamLimiter, 0, globalLimiter, 0);
}
@Test(timeout = 60000)
public void testUnsetDisableFeatureAfterPermitsExceeded() throws Exception {
SettableFeature feature = new SettableFeature("test", 10000);
SimplePermitLimiter streamLimiter = createPermitLimiter(false, 1, feature);
SimplePermitLimiter globalLimiter = createPermitLimiter(false, Integer.MAX_VALUE, feature);
WriteLimiter limiter = new WriteLimiter("test", streamLimiter, globalLimiter);
limiter.acquire();
limiter.acquire();
limiter.acquire();
limiter.acquire();
assertPermits(streamLimiter, 4, globalLimiter, 4);
feature.set(0);
limiter.release();
assertPermits(streamLimiter, 3, globalLimiter, 3);
try {
limiter.acquire();
fail("should have thrown stream limit exception");
} catch (OverCapacityException ex) {
}
assertPermits(streamLimiter, 3, globalLimiter, 3);
limiter.release();
limiter.release();
limiter.release();
assertPermits(streamLimiter, 0, globalLimiter, 0);
}
@Test(timeout = 60000)
public void testUnsetDisableFeatureBeforePermitsExceeded() throws Exception {
SettableFeature feature = new SettableFeature("test", 0);
SimplePermitLimiter streamLimiter = createPermitLimiter(false, 1, feature);
SimplePermitLimiter globalLimiter = createPermitLimiter(false, Integer.MAX_VALUE, feature);
WriteLimiter limiter = new WriteLimiter("test", streamLimiter, globalLimiter);
limiter.acquire();
try {
limiter.acquire();
fail("should have thrown stream limit exception");
} catch (OverCapacityException ex) {
}
assertPermits(streamLimiter, 1, globalLimiter, 1);
feature.set(10000);
limiter.acquire();
assertPermits(streamLimiter, 2, globalLimiter, 2);
}
@Test(timeout = 60000)
public void testDarkmodeGlobalUnderStreamOver() throws Exception {
SimplePermitLimiter streamLimiter = createPermitLimiter(true, 1);
SimplePermitLimiter globalLimiter = createPermitLimiter(true, 2);
WriteLimiter limiter = new WriteLimiter("test", streamLimiter, globalLimiter);
limiter.acquire();
limiter.acquire();
assertPermits(streamLimiter, 2, globalLimiter, 2);
limiter.release();
limiter.release();
assertPermits(streamLimiter, 0, globalLimiter, 0);
}
@Test(timeout = 60000)
public void testDarkmodeGlobalOverStreamUnder() throws Exception {
SimplePermitLimiter streamLimiter = createPermitLimiter(true, 2);
SimplePermitLimiter globalLimiter = createPermitLimiter(true, 1);
WriteLimiter limiter = new WriteLimiter("test", streamLimiter, globalLimiter);
limiter.acquire();
limiter.acquire();
assertPermits(streamLimiter, 2, globalLimiter, 2);
limiter.release();
assertPermits(streamLimiter, 1, globalLimiter, 1);
limiter.release();
assertPermits(streamLimiter, 0, globalLimiter, 0);
}
void assertPermits(SimplePermitLimiter streamLimiter, int streamPermits, SimplePermitLimiter globalLimiter, int globalPermits) {
assertEquals(streamPermits, streamLimiter.getPermits());
assertEquals(globalPermits, globalLimiter.getPermits());
}
}
